Ubiquitinated Protein & Its Detection Methods

Ubiquitin is a highly conserved polypeptides, which is formed by 76 amino acid residues. It can covalently connect with one or more lysine residues on the intracellular target protein under the condition of enzymatic reactions catalyze. Ubiquitin itself contains seven lysine residues, which can also connect to each other to form a multi-ubiquitin chains (polyubiquitin chain). The present study shows that if the first 48 lysine residues polyubiquitin chain and connected to the modified protein will mediate target protein into the proteasome and are degraded; if the protein is modified with other sites, such as the first 63 lysine residues connected to the target protein signaling pathway function can play without being degraded.

Approaches for detecting ubiquitinated proteins

Before this detection, we should firstly know following three points:

1. Proteins, which have been ubiquitinated.
2. Lysine residue, which occurred ubiquitination.
3. Ubiquitination prediction

Then the aims for this detection are that what molecular effects are produced by ubiquitinated proteins and its effect on downstream signaling pathways.

The methods and processes of content above:

Western blot and strip

Detecting ubiquitinated protein band with western blot and stripping the membrane, which should be recorded with pictures. And then it should react with specific proteins antibodies and specific ubiquitination sites antibodies, whose color will be recorded. By comparing the positive bands to judge the occurrence of protein ubiquitination of a specific site preliminarily.

Western blot and immunoprecipitation

To seperate the special proteins and proteins, which has been combined with the special proteins by using co-immunoprecipitation. And then separated proteins should be analyzed by SDS and western blot. This method can make it clear that which lysine residue of certain protein has occurred ubiquitylation.

In vitro ubiquitination assay

Transfecting the target genes with 293 cells to make it express abundantly. And then target proteins will be extracted in 24 hours. In vitro reaction buffer, we should incubate ubiquitinated proteins and protein causing protein A ubiquitination with UBE1, UbeH13-Uev 1 a heterodimer complex and HA-ubiquitin. The products should be analyzed by IP and WB. This method can show the E3 ligase, which cause the proteins causing the protein ubiquitination.

In vitro ubiquitin-binding assay

Transfecting target proteins with 293 cells. And purifying it after its abundant expression or extracting endogenous proteins directly. And then incubating it with K63- or K48-linked ubiquitin chain petides in vitro. After that is should be detected with SDS and ubiquitin antibodies. This method is used to determine lysine residues, which are easy to be ubiquitinated.

These are four methods for detecting protein ubiquitination.
